Definition of Escapement
Es`cape´ment
n.
1.
The
act
of
escaping
;
escape
.
2.
Way
of
escape
;
vent
.
An
escapement
for
youthful
high
spirits
.
- G. Eliot.
3.
The
contrivance
in
a
timepiece
which
connects
the
train
of
wheel
work
with
the
pendulum
or
balance
,
giving
to
the
latter
the
impulse
by
which
it
is
kept
in
vibration
; -
so
called
because
it
allows
a
tooth
to
escape
from
a
pallet
at
each
vibration
.
